For lengthy, people have been deployed to execute a few of the most redundant duties within the title of processes and workflows. This dedication of human energy to carry out monotonous jobs has resulted in lowered utilization of talents and sources into resolving considerations that really demand human capabilities.
Nevertheless, with the onset of Synthetic Intelligence (AI), particularly Gen AI and its allied applied sciences equivalent to Giant Language Fashions (LLMs), we have now efficiently automated redundant duties. This has paved the way in which for people to refine their abilities and take up area of interest duties which have precise real-world affect.
Concurrently, enterprises have uncovered newer potential for AI within the type of use circumstances and purposes in numerous streams, more and more counting on them for insights, actionable, battle resolutions, and even end result predictions. Statistics additionally reveal that by 2025, over 750mn apps might be powered by LLMs.
As LLMs acquire elevated prominence, it’s on us tech specialists and tech enterprises to unlock stage 2, which is grounded on accountable and moral AI facets. With LLMs influencing choices in delicate domains equivalent to healthcare, authorized, supply-chain and extra, the mandate for foolproof and hermetic fashions turns into inevitable.
So, how will we guarantee LLMs are reliable? How will we add a layer of credibility and accountability whereas growing LLMs?
LLM analysis is the reply. On this article, we’ll anecdotally break down what LLM analysis is, some LLM analysis metrics, its significance, and extra.
Let’s get began.
What Is LLM Analysis?
Within the easiest of phrases, LLM analysis is the method of assessing the performance of an LLM in facets surrounding:
- Accuracy
- Effectivity
- Belief
- And security
The evaluation of an LLM serves as a sworn statement to its efficiency and provides builders and stakeholders a transparent understanding of its strengths, limitations, scope of enchancment, and extra. Such analysis practices additionally guarantee LLM initiatives are constantly optimized and calibrated so they’re perpetually aligned with enterprise targets and supposed outcomes.
Why Do We Want To Consider LLMs?
LLMs like GPT 4.o, Gemini and extra have gotten more and more integral in our on a regular basis lives. Other than shopper facets, enterprises are customizing and adopting LLMs to execute a myriad of their organizational duties via deployment of chatbots, in healthcare to automate appointment scheduling, in logistics for fleet administration and extra.
Because the dependence on LLMs will increase, it turns into essential for such fashions to generate responses which can be correct and contextual. The method of LLM analysis boils all the way down to elements equivalent to:
- Enhancing the performance and efficiency of LLMs and strengthening their credibility
- Enhancing security by making certain mitigation of bias and the technology of dangerous and hateful responses
- Assembly the wants of customers so they’re able to producing human-like responses in conditions each informal and important
- Figuring out gaps by way of areas a mannequin wants enchancment
- Optimizing area adaptation for seamless business integration
- Testing multilingual assist and extra
Functions Of LLM Efficiency Analysis
LLMs are crucial deployments in enterprises. At the same time as a software for a shopper, LLMs have critical implications in decision-making.
That’s why rigorously evaluating them goes past an educational train. It’s a stringent course of that must be inculcated at a tradition stage to make sure damaging penalties are at bay.
To present you a fast glimpse of why LLM evaluations are essential, listed here are a number of causes:
Assess Efficiency
LLM efficiency is one thing that’s constantly optimized even after deployment. Their assessments give a hen’s eye view on how they perceive human language and enter, how they exactly course of necessities, and their retrieval of related info.
That is extensively carried out by incorporating numerous metrics which can be aligned with LLM and enterprise targets.
Establish & Mitigate Bias
LLM evaluations play a vital function in detecting and eliminating bias from fashions. In the course of the mannequin coaching section, bias via coaching datasets are launched. Such datasets usually end in one-sided outcomes which can be innately prejudiced. And enterprises can’t afford to launch LLMs loaded with bias. To constantly take away bias from programs, evaluations are performed to make the mannequin extra goal and moral.
Floor Fact Analysis
This methodology analyzes and compares outcomes generated by LLMS with precise details and outcomes. By labeling outcomes, outcomes are weighed in in opposition to their accuracy and relevance. This utility permits builders to grasp the strengths and limitations of the mannequin, permitting them to additional take corrective measures and optimization methods.
Mannequin Comparability
Enterprise-level integrations of LLMs contain numerous elements such because the area proficiency of the mannequin, the datasets its skilled on and extra. In the course of the goal analysis section, LLMs are evaluated based mostly on their fashions to assist stakeholders perceive which mannequin would supply the most effective and exact outcomes for his or her line of enterprise.
LLM Analysis Frameworks
There are numerous frameworks and metrics out there to evaluate the performance of LLMs. Nevertheless, there is no such thing as a rule of thumb to implement and the choice to an LLM analysis framework boils all the way down to particular undertaking necessities and targets. With out getting too technical, let’s perceive some frequent frameworks.
Context-specific Analysis
This framework weighs the area or enterprise context of an enterprise and its overarching function in opposition to the performance of the LLM being constructed. This strategy ensures responses, tone, language, and different facets of output are tailor-made for context and relevance and that there aren’t any appropriations to keep away from reputational harm.
As an example, an LLM designed to be deployed in faculties or educational establishments might be evaluated for language, bias, misinformation, toxicity, and extra. Then again an LLM being deployed as a chatbot for an eCommerce retailer might be evaluated for textual content evaluation, accuracy of output generated, potential to resolve conflicts in minimal dialog and extra.
For higher understanding, right here’s an inventory of analysis metrics superb for context-specific analysis:
Relevance | Does the mannequin’s response align with a consumer’s immediate/question? |
Query-answer accuracy | This evaluates a mannequin’s potential to generate responses to direct and simple prompts. |
BLEU rating | Abbreviated as Bilingual Analysis Understudy, this assesses a mannequin’s output and human references to see how intently the responses are to that of a human. |
Toxicity | This checks if the responses are honest and clear, devoid of dangerous or hateful content material. |
ROGUE Rating | ROGUE stands for Recall-oriented Understudy For Gisting Analysis and understands the ratio of the reference content material to its generated abstract. |
Hallucination | How correct and factually proper is a response generated by the mannequin? Does the mannequin hallucinate illogical or weird responses? |
Person-driven Analysis
Thought to be the gold customary of evaluations, this includes the presence of a human in scrutinizing LLM performances. Whereas that is unimaginable to grasp the intricacies concerned in prompts and outcomes, it’s usually time-consuming particularly in terms of large-scale ambitions.
UI/UX Metrics
There’s the usual efficiency of an LLM on one facet and there’s consumer expertise on the opposite. Each have stark variations in terms of selecting analysis metrics. To kickstart the method, you possibly can take into account elements equivalent to:
- Person satisfaction: How does a consumer really feel when utilizing an LLM? Do they get pissed off when their prompts are misunderstood?
- Response Time: Do customers really feel the mannequin takes an excessive amount of time to generate a response? How glad are customers with the performance, velocity, and accuracy of a selected mannequin?
- Error restoration: Errors occur however successfully does a mannequin rectify its mistake and generate an acceptable response? Does it retain its credibility and belief by producing superb responses?
Person expertise metrics units an LLM analysis benchmark in these facets, giving builders insights on how you can optimize them for efficiency.
Benchmark Duties
One of many different outstanding frameworks consists of assessments equivalent to MT Bench, AlpacaEval, MMMU, GAIA and extra. These frameworks comprise units of standardized questions and responses to gauge the efficiency of fashions. One of many main variations between the opposite approaches and that is that they’re generic frameworks that are perfect for goal evaluation of LLMs. They perform over generic datasets and will not present essential insights for the performance of fashions with respect to particular domains, intentions, or function.
LLM Mannequin Analysis Vs. LLM System Evaluationz
Let’s go just a little extra in-depth in understanding the various kinds of LLM analysis methods. By changing into aware of an overarching spectrum of analysis methodologies, builders and stakeholders are in a greater place to judge fashions higher and contextually align their targets and outcomes.
Other than LLM mannequin analysis, there’s a distinct idea known as LLM system analysis. Whereas the previous helps gauge a mannequin’s goal efficiency and capabilities, LLM system analysis assesses a mannequin’s efficiency in a particular context, setting, or framework. This lays emphasis on a mannequin’s area and real-world utility and a consumer’s interplay surrounding it.
Mannequin Analysis | System Analysis |
It focuses on the efficiency and performance of a mannequin. | It focuses on the effectiveness of a mannequin with respect to its particular use case. |
Generic, all encompassing analysis throughout numerous eventualities and metrics | Immediate engineering and optimization to boost consumer expertise |
Incorporation of metrics equivalent to coherence, complexity, MMLU and extra | Incorporation of metrics equivalent to recall, precision, system-specific success charges, and extra |
Analysis outcomes instantly affect foundational improvement | Analysis outcomes influences and enhances consumer satisfaction and interplay |
Understanding The Variations Between On-line And Offline Evaluations
LLMs could be evaluated each on-line and offline. Every presents its personal set of professionals and cons and is good for particular necessities. To grasp this additional, let’s break down the variations.
On-line Analysis | Offline Analysis |
The analysis occurs between LLMs and actual user-fed knowledge. | That is performed in a acutely aware integration atmosphere in opposition to present datasets. |
This captures the efficiency of an LLM stay and gauges consumer satisfaction and suggestions in actual time. | This ensures efficiency meets fundamental functioning standards eligible for the mannequin to be taken stay. |
That is superb as a post-launch train, additional optimizing LLM efficiency for enhanced consumer expertise. | That is superb as a pre-launch train, making the mannequin market-ready. |
LLM Analysis Greatest Practices
Whereas the method of evaluating LLMs is advanced, a scientific strategy could make it seamless from each enterprise operations and LLM functionalities facets. Let’s have a look at some greatest practices to judge LLMs.
Incorporate LLMOps
Philosophically, LLMOps is much like DevOps, focussing predominantly on automation, steady improvement, and elevated collaboration. The distinction right here is that LLMOps substantiates collaboration amongst knowledge scientists, operations groups, and machine studying builders.
Apart from, it additionally aids in automating machine studying pipelines and has frameworks to constantly monitor mannequin efficiency for suggestions and optimization. The whole incorporation of LLMOps ensures your fashions are scalable, agile, and dependable other than making certain they’re compliant to mandates and regulatory frameworks.
Most Actual-world Analysis
One of many time-tested methods to implement an hermetic LLM analysis course of is to conduct as many real-world assessments as doable. Whereas evaluations in managed environments are good to gauge mannequin stability and performance, the litmus check lies when fashions work together with people on the opposite facet. They’re susceptible to surprising and weird eventualities, compelling them to be taught new response methods and mechanisms.
An Arsenal Of Analysis Metrics
A monolithic strategy to that includes analysis metrics solely brings in a tunnel-vision syndrome to mannequin performances. For a extra holistic view that gives an all-encompassing view of LLM efficiency, it’s instructed you’ve a various evaluation metric.
This ought to be as broad and exhaustive as doable together with coherence, fluency, precision, relevance, contextual comprehension, time taken for retrieval, and extra. The extra the evaluation touchpoints, the higher the optimization.
Essential Benchmarking Measures To Optimize LLM Efficiency
Benchmarking of a mannequin is crucial to make sure refinement and optimization processes are kickstarted. To pave the way in which for a seamless benchmarking course of, a scientific and structured strategy is required. Right here, we establish a 5-step course of that can aid you accomplish this.
- Curation of benchmark duties that includes numerous easy and sophisticated duties so benchmarking occurs throughout the spectrum of an mannequin’s complexities and capabilities
- Dataset preparation, that includes bias-free and distinctive datasets to evaluate a mannequin’s efficiency
- Incorporation of LLM gateway and fine-tuning processes to make sure LLMs seamlessly deal with language duties
- Assessments utilizing the suitable metrics to objectively strategy the benchmarking course of and lay a stable basis for the mannequin’s performance
- Consequence evaluation and iterative suggestions, triggering a loop of inference-optimization course of for additional refinement of mannequin efficiency
The completion of this 5-step course of offers you a holistic understanding of your LLM and its performance via numerous eventualities and metrics. As a abstract of the efficiency analysis metrics used, right here’s a fast desk:
Metric | Objective | Use Case |
Perplexity | To measure any uncertainty in predicting subsequent tokens | Language proficiency |
ROGUE | To match reference textual content and a mannequin’s output | Summarization-specific duties |
Variety | To judge the number of outputs generated | Variation and creativity in responses |
Human Analysis | To have people within the loop to find out subjective understanding and expertise with a mannequin | Coherence and relevance |
LLM Analysis: A Complicated But Indispensable Course of
Assessing LLMs is very technical and sophisticated. With that stated, it’s additionally a course of that can not be skipped contemplating its cruciality. For one of the best ways ahead, enterprises can combine and match LLM analysis frameworks to strike a stability between assessing the relative performance of their fashions to optimizing them for area integration within the GTM (Go To Market) section.
Other than their performance, LLM analysis can be crucial to increment confidence in AI programs enterprises construct. As Shaip is an advocate of moral and accountable AI methods and approaches, we all the time vouch and voice for stringent evaluation ways.
We really imagine this text launched you to the idea of analysis of LLMs and that you’ve a greater concept of the way it’s essential for protected and safe innovation and AI development.